Holy Land : a wilderness like Eden /
A surprising variety of plants, animals and insects bring vitality to the seemingly barren landscape of Israel's Negev Desert. It is a realm of the extreme, with scorching days, freezing nights, terminal drought and flash floods, making this one of the harshest environments on earth.
